Output 97ec4de9c9f56465d00a0439c868f0b034366c153fb5c7efc0b27f9a282259ed:2

value
43637329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e17a5f2452a248d23be7604bd3f9e263986764 OP_EQUAL
address
37hMxVwdCWXd9FNMo9ditp67MrWyu9EJ66
transaction
97ec4de9c9f56465d00a0439c868f0b034366c153fb5c7efc0b27f9a282259ed
confirmations
293766
spent
true